> Pulseaudio will be downgraded to 0.9.19 due to integrating patches for policy framework and voice call features. We plan to integrate the new PA package after the holiday (Jan 3) for QA's testing.
> I will do the sanity test before submitting the new package. However, for the owner of packages which requires PA, you'd better do the check beforehand to avoid any potential issues. Here lists the packages (20) which depends on PA.
>
> * Trunk:Testing : 12
> audiomanager phonon pavucontrol tone-generator libcanberra qt-mobility pulseaudio-modules-meego monitor-call-audio-setting-mid alsa-plugins gst-plugins-good libao SDL
> * Trunk:Netbook : 3
> gnome-media gnome-settings-daemon meego-panel-devices
> * Trunk:Handset : 2
> meego-handset-statusindicators meegotouchcp-bluetooth
> * Trunk:IVI : 3
> hfdialer audio_management speech-dispatcher

There are a lot of bug fixes in:
http://meego.gitorious.org/maemo-multimedia/pulseaudio/trees/master/debian/patches
Some of them are already integrated into devel:multimedia/pulseaudio.
About integrating (some of) those:
Should we follow the normal process, or could a lighter process be
concidered for them? Waiting for some segfaults to appear _in_MeeGo_,
before submitting an already existing patch for it, sounds inefficient.
Maybe the ones that are purely fixes and contain no new features could
be gathered into one submit, which then describes all the things they
are supposed to fix. I mean without confirming each bug on meego, filing
a bug and going though the usual.
For example, here is a very simple typo fix, that fixes audio input for
resource policy(not yet integrated):
http://build.meego.com/request/show/11301
Do we need a bug for it BTW, this not being in T:T yet?
